I purchased a *** **** EV+ from Vroom which was going out of business, but I proceeded with the delivery since they said they still had to honor the contract. During delivery it was put in the shop due to the battery issue during inspection. I was told that it was resolved and they delivered the car. Once I received the car 3 days later I had to file a claim because the battery was not operating at full capacity. I took it to ****** ***** *** to have it evaluated and almost did not make it to them because the battery turtled and slowed down and battery lost charge within 15 mins. The dealership has now had the car for 88 days with a tech line case on the battery because they do not know how to fix the issue. Vroom ensured that since I opened the case within the 7 days that if I wanted to return the vehicle I could and that if the issue was not covered by dealership to send the info to vroom because of warranty. When I contacted vroom again when waiting on a resolution form dealership, I was told they were closing the case because they spoke to the dealership and was told that the issue would be covered u see warranty. I expressed that I would rather return the vehicle and I was told then that they would not be able to take a return because they were closing and because the dealership said it would be covered. This is outrageous because I was told the return would be honered because I opened the case in 7 days. The car issue is still unresolved. Im paying a car note for a vehicle I dont have and they have no resolution to fix. The car is literally a lemon. Ive been in a rental and dont know what to do at this point.Initial Complaint

Never received title. Paid my loan off early and was told that I would receive my title within 2 weeks. Never got title. Called back 3-4 weeks later and was told title was sent and must have been lost, and that they would send me a lien release. 4 weeks later and no release. Called back a third time and was told they would expedite my lien release. Its been 3 weeks and still havent received it.Business Response
Date: 04/22/2024
Hello Mr. ********************************** is the dealership that sold you the vehicle; we do not hold the lien for the vehicle. The contracted lienholder for your purchase was *********************************, N.A (*****). If you are entitled to a lien-free title (the lien has been paid in full), please contact ***** to request the title be released to you. If you already received a paid in full letter or lien release from ****** you can also submit that letter to *** to request a replacement title be issued to you directly. Vroom is unable to assist in this matter, as we do not hold the title or lien for the vehicle.
